Dead Eye was the incredibly popular game mechanic introduced as far back as Red Dead Revolver that made everyone feel like a true gunslinger. Once activated, time would slow down and the player could pick off several enemies in one sequence, or even disarm people. This gained even wider traction in RDR , and now it’s back. In RDR , John famously swam like a rock when he so much as put a toe into deep water. Not even his horses could keep him from sinking. And speaking of tuberculosis, how is it that Arthur didn’t infect a single person? TB is a very contagious disease that spreads when an infected person coughs or sneezes, and only a few droplets of spit are required for infection. And, in case you weren’t paying attention, Arthur is hacking all over the place by the end of the story. Yet no one became sick. The epilogue catches us up on various characters’ fates, and not a single one of them has passed from tuberculosis.
